ORANGE : 3 Library Branches Will Reduce Hours

Share

Beginning today, three of the Orange Public Library’s four branches will reduce their operating hours in a cutback that library officials blame on a city hiring freeze.

Because budget cuts a year ago forced a freeze on a dozen positions, ranging from librarian down to page, branch hours had to be trimmed “to continue to provide quality service,” said Eugenia Wong, the library’s technical services manager.

The Main Library will maintain its current schedule.

The El Modena, Santiago Hills and Taft branches will now be closed on Fridays, and Saturday hours will be shortened at each site.

Each of the three branches will also close on another weekday.

The El Modena branch will be open from noon to 9 p.m. on Mondays and Wednesdays, from 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. on Tuesdays and from 1 to 5 p.m. on Saturdays.

It will be closed on Thursdays, Fridays and Sundays.

The Santiago Hills branch will be open from 11 a.m. to 8 p.m. on Tuesdays and Wednesdays, from 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. on Thursdays and from 9 a.m. to noon on Saturdays.

It will be closed on Mondays, Fridays and Sundays.

The Taft branch will be open noon to 9 p.m. on Mondays and Tuesdays, 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. on Thursdays and noon to 5 p.m. on Saturdays.

It will be closed on Wednesdays, Fridays and Sundays.

The Main Branch will continue to be open 10 a.m. to 9 p.m. Mondays through Thursdays and 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. Fridays and Saturdays.
